
The Casio W217H vs F91W comparison is one of the most practical battles in the cheap Casio world. Both watches are simple, affordable, lightweight digital Casios with a stopwatch, alarm, calendar, LED light and long battery life. But they are not made for the same type of buyer.
The Casio F91W is the icon. It is thinner, lighter, smaller, more famous and easier to love if you care about classic Casio history. The Casio W217H is the more practical modern choice. It has a bigger case, larger digits, better readability, better water resistance and a stronger everyday tool-watch feel.
My honest opinion is simple: the F91W is cooler, but the W217H is more useful.
If you want the legendary cheap Casio, buy the F91W. If you want a better daily digital watch for normal adult use, the W217H makes more sense.

Casio W217H vs F91W: Main Differences
| Feature |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Watch type | Classic small digital Casio | Larger practical digital Casio |
| Case size | 38.2 x 35.2 x 8.5 mm | 43.1 x 41.2 x 10.5 mm |
| Weight | 21 g | 32 g |
| Case material | Resin | Resin |
| Band | Resin band | Resin band |
| Glass | Resin glass | Resin glass |
| Water resistance | Water Resistant | 50m water resistance |
| Battery | CR2016 | CR2016 |
| Approx. battery life | About 7 years | About 7 years |
| Stopwatch | Yes | Yes |
| Alarm | Yes | Yes |
| LED light | Basic and weak | Better, more useful |
| Display size | Small | Larger |
| Best for | Icon status, comfort, small wrists | Readability, water confidence, daily use |
The W217H is not just a bigger F91W, but that is the easiest way to understand it. It keeps the cheap Casio digital idea and makes it more readable and practical.
Design and Style
The F91W has the design everyone knows: small black resin case, blue outline, red WR mark and yellow text. It looks basic, cheap and iconic in the best possible way. It is not trying to look expensive. That is part of its charm.
The W217H looks more modern and more functional. It is still simple, but the case is larger, the display is bigger and the whole watch feels more like a practical daily digital watch than a tiny retro object.
| Style factor |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Overall look | Small, retro, iconic | Larger, cleaner, more modern |
| Wrist presence | Very small | Noticeably larger |
| Retro appeal | Stronger | Moderate |
| Tool-watch feel | Basic | Stronger |
| Fashion charm | Stronger among Casio fans | More normal and practical |
| Best with casual outfits | Both | Both |
| Best as a tiny classic | F91W | Not the point |
| Best as a readable digital watch | Not ideal | W217H |
My personal opinion: the F91W has more soul. The W217H looks less legendary, but it works better as a normal watch.

Comfort and Wrist Feel
The F91W wins for pure comfort.
At about 21 g and only 8.5 mm thick, it almost disappears on the wrist. It is one of the easiest watches to wear all day. If you have small wrists, dislike bulky watches or want something you can sleep with, the F91W is excellent.
The W217H is still light, but it is noticeably bigger. At 32 g, it is not heavy at all, but compared with the F91W, you will feel the difference.
| Comfort factor |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Weight | Lighter | Still light, but heavier |
| Thickness | Thinner | Thicker |
| Small wrist fit | Better | Depends on wrist size |
| Sleep comfort | Better | Less ideal |
| Sport comfort | Excellent | Good |
| Sleeve comfort | Better | Still fine |
| Wrist presence | Minimal | More noticeable |
If your wrist is around 6.5 inches or smaller, the F91W will probably look more proportional. The W217H can still work, but it has a larger digital-watch presence.
My honest view: F91W is more comfortable. W217H is more useful.
Display and Readability
This is where the W217H wins clearly.
The biggest practical weakness of the F91W is the small display. It is readable, but it is not generous. The digits are small, the screen is compact and the weak light does not help much at night.
The W217H has larger time digits and a bigger display. That makes it much easier to glance at during the day, while walking, working, driving, exercising or checking time quickly.
| Display factor |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Digit size | Small | Larger |
| Quick glance readability | Acceptable | Better |
| Best for older eyes | Not ideal | Better |
| Best for night reading | Weak | Better |
| Display layout | Classic but cramped | More open |
| Practical usability | Good | Better |
This is the main reason I think the W217H is the better daily watch for most people. You do not need to admire the watch every time. Sometimes you just need to read the time quickly.
Backlight
The F91W backlight is famous, but not because it is good. It is weak and uneven. It works, but it feels old and basic.
The W217H has a better LED backlight. It is not a premium smartwatch-style display, but it is much more useful in real life.
| Backlight factor |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Brightness | Weak | Better |
| Display coverage | Uneven | Better |
| Night readability | Basic | More practical |
| Bedside use | Not great | Better |
| Main criticism | Weak light | Less iconic design |
If you often check the time at night, the W217H is the easier watch to live with. The F91W light is charming only if you like old-school limitations.
Water Resistance
The W217H has a real practical advantage here. It offers 50m water resistance, while the F91W is listed only as Water Resistant.
In normal language, both can handle everyday splashes, rain and hand washing. But the W217H gives more confidence for daily water exposure.

Important: I still would not call the W217H a true swimming watch in the same way I would trust a G-Shock DW-5600. But compared with the F91W, it is clearly the better choice around water.
If water matters a lot, buy a G-Shock. If you only want a cheap Casio with better daily water confidence, the W217H is the better pick.
Durability and Build Quality
Neither watch is a G-Shock. That needs to be clear.
The F91W and W217H are basic resin digital Casios. They are reliable for the price, but they are not shock-resistant rugged watches. They can survive normal life, but they are not made for serious abuse.
That said, the W217H feels more substantial because it is bigger. The F91W feels more delicate, even if it can survive a surprising amount of abuse in real life.
| Durability factor |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Daily reliability | Good | Good |
| Rough work | Not ideal | Better, but still not G-Shock |
| Case feel | Small and light | More substantial |
| Drop confidence | Basic | Slightly better feel |
| Water confidence | Basic | Better |
| Strap | Basic resin | Basic resin |
| Long-term beater use | Good | Better for practical wear |
My practical view: if you want a tiny casual watch, F91W is enough. If you want a cheap daily beater that feels a bit more useful, W217H is better.
Functions and Everyday Use
Functionally, both watches are simple. Neither is packed with advanced features, and that is part of the appeal.
| Function | Casio F91W | Casio W217H |
|---|---|---|
| Time | Yes | Yes |
| 12/24-hour format | Yes | Yes |
| Daily alarm | Yes | Yes |
| Hourly time signal | Yes | Yes |
| Stopwatch | Yes | Yes |
| Calendar | Yes | Yes |
| LED light | Yes | Yes |
| Smart features | No | No |
| Sensors | No | No |
The difference is not the feature list. The difference is how easy the watch is to use. The W217H is easier to read. The F91W is easier to forget you are wearing.

Better Alternatives to Consider
| Model | Why consider it |
|---|---|
| Casio F91W | The original cheap digital icon |
| Casio W217H | Bigger, easier-to-read F91W-style alternative |
| Casio F105W | F91W-like size with better light |
| Casio W-59 | Similar small digital style with better water confidence |
| Casio W-800H | Larger display and very practical daily use |
| Casio AE-1200 | More features, world time and bigger display |
| Casio A158 | F91W-style functions with metal bracelet |
| Casio A168 | Metal style with better backlight |
| G-Shock DW-5600 | Better if you want true toughness |
If you want a small icon, choose F91W. If you want readability, choose W217H. If you want durability, skip both and get a G-Shock.
